SOA Consortium to Present Top 5 Insights Learned from Executive Summits
Free Webcast to review results of SOA Executive Summit focus
group meetings held with FORTUNE 1000 business executives

Needham, MA, USA – March 13, 2007 – The SOA Consortium™, where SOA Means Business™, today announced that it will present a free webcast on the “Top 5 Insights” learned from their recently completed SOA Executive Summit focus group meetings. Leading executives from FORTUNE 1000™ corporations, major government agencies and non-governmental organizations, provided candid feedback on the mission, vision, strategies and tactics of the SOA Consortium and participated in a lively roundtable discussion on real-world SOA implementation opportunities and challenges.

In an open webcast on Tuesday, March 20, 2007 at 2:00 p.m. EDT, Richard Mark Soley, Ph.D., executive director of the SOA Consortium, and Brenda Michelson, principal of Elemental Links, will share “The Top 5 Insights” from the Summits. All are welcome to participate in this live webcast with Q&A session.

“The SOA Executive Summits were a huge success, thanks to the participation of smart, insightful and outspoken C-level executives. The participants were actively engaged in the conversation right from the opening presentation of the SOA Consortium’s mission and vision. From their enthusiastic responses, it was obvious that there is a clear demand for the SOA Consortium and its advocacy mission,” said Richard Mark Soley, Ph.D., executive director, SOA consortium. “The feedback we received is that we need to focus on the business issues of defining, integrating, measuring and reusing business services. Those comments have validated the SOA Consortium’s mission and we know that we are headed down the right path.”

A more detailed presentation of the findings will be presented to the SOA Consortium’s members at their inaugural meeting in San Diego, California on March 28-29.

About The SOA Consortium
SOA Consortium founding enterprise members include Fortune 200 companies in Financial Services, Travel, Manufacturing, Retail and Telecommunications. Founding sponsors are BEA Systems, Inc., Cisco, IBM Corporation, and SAP AG. Participants in the consortium to date include: Avis Budget Car Rental, Bank of America, CellExchange, Inc., Integration Consortium, HP, Object Management Group, and WebEx Communications. Any organization may join the SOA Consortium. The SOA Consortium is managed by the Object Management Group.
